How they compare

Sudan (former) currently reports 1,452 m3 against 1,004 m3 in Mongolia, a difference of 448 m3.

That makes Sudan (former)'s figure about 1.4 times Mongolia's.

Across all 5 years both countries report, Sudan (former) has been ahead every year.

Mongolia ranks 55th and Sudan (former) ranks 54th of 86 countries.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
